Product Description
This Hynix HMT42GR7MFR4C-PBT3-AE is a 16GB DDR3 Registered DIMM (RDIMM) module, engineered for high-performance server and workstation environments. It operates at a frequency of 1600MHz, providing substantial memory bandwidth crucial for demanding applications. The 'PBT3-AE' suffix indicates specific manufacturing and quality assurance standards employed by Hynix for this component. The module is ECC (Error-Correcting Code) registered memory. The registered design incorporates an onboard buffer that mitigates the electrical load on the memory controller, enabling systems to support higher memory capacities and configurations. ECC functionality is essential for maintaining data integrity by detecting and correcting errors, thereby ensuring the stability and reliability of critical server operations. Featuring a dual-rank (2Rx4) architecture, this RDIMM can enhance performance through efficient memory interleaving. The CAS Latency (CL) is rated at CL11, representing a balance between operational speed and timing precision.
